Service introduction

Services include: • Two prenatal planning sessions • 24/7 on-call support beginning at 38 weeks • Continuous labor and birth support • Immediate postpartum support after delivery • Text and phone support throughout pregnancy • One postpartum follow-up visit My care is trauma-informed, culturally responsive, and centered on informed consent and physiological birth support. Whether you are planning a home, birth center, or hospital birth.
